Alburquerque started his professional career in the minor leagues and made his MLB debut in 2011. He played as a relief pitcher for the Detroit Tigers, showcasing his skills during multiple seasons. He contributed to the team reaching the playoffs and played an essential role in their bullpen strategy. Known for a powerful fastball and effective slider, he secured a place in the roster for significant games, helping his team compete at a high level.
